The vibrant medium of pastel has been a favorite of artists such as Willem de Kooning for the last four centuries because of its luminosity and versatility. Working from still-life arrangements in studio sessions, students learn to achieve the brilliant and subtle effects characteristic of the medium.

Throughout the course, lectures on color theory, color mixing, and composition are given. Demonstrations on color layering and blending are also included. For inspiration and ideas, works by master pastellists are viewed and discussed.

Students may work in chalk or oil pastel. Students should have basic drawing skills.
